Bio

Chris Martin & The Trouble Shooters were formed at Christmas time 2004, with the simple intention of putting together a set in order to play a boxing day performance for friends and family who were home for the holidays. 4 1/2 years later, the band has developed a strong and loyal following in Eastern Canada with their busy performance schedule, as well as with their debut LP "Down On Agricola Street".

At first, the marriage seemed unlikely- traditional solo acoustic blues singer Chris Martin paired with bassist Stu Hayward, and drummer Rob Fris- who, at the age of 22 were both already becoming veterans of Halifax's hard-rock scene. Gladly, the mix of styles clicked, and the trio began to develop their own brand of hard driving, raw blues and rock n' roll.

In the Fall of 2006 Mike Nahirnak joined the group, rounding out the 4 piece line-up that exists to this day. His scorching lead guitar lines and twangy pedal steel are the perfect compliment to Chris' blues licks and rhythm guitar style. Add in the urgency of Rob and Stu's drums and bass, plus the topical narratives of Chris' lyrics, and there you have it- Cmart & The Trouble Shooters!

In June, 2008 The band independently released "Down On Agricola Street", a full length album produced by Brad Conrad. The recording was named after the bustling Halifax neighborhood where all of the band members live, and includes fan-favorites such as "She's Wild", "No Dice", "Drive 'er Like You Stole 'er" (an instrumental 'car chase' featuring a drum solo that will blow your speakers!!), and the title track that will make you feel like you are there yourself!

In support of this release, They have performed to enthusiastic crowds in Toronto (The Velvet Underground), Montreal (Barfly), Sydney (Maple Leaf Lounge) Truro (Trurock Festival), and Halifax (Seahorse Tavern, Gus' Pub, Tribeca, Minstrel's, Foggy Goggle etc. etc...), and have still found time to lend their talents to charitable events such as "War Child" Canada's "Keep The Beat" (a fundraiser music marathon that raised $6000 at Citadel High School in Halifax!).

In the coming year, Chris Martin & The Trouble Shooters plan to record and release their second full length recording, and are also planning to tour Canada.
